Your career at CA Immo
The company specialising in office properties in the capital cities of Central Europe promises varied job roles, autonomy at work and an international environment. More than 400 employees form the foundation of success for the Group. These professional, responsible and committed staff members are active across all areas of the real estate industry, from land and project development to marketing and property management, from portfolio management and trading to technical, commercial and legal areas.

The CA Immo Academy: kick-starting your career
Promoting personal career paths, establishing and enhancing professional expertise and management skills, team building measures, organisational development and company health promotion are cornerstones of human resource management at CA Immo.
Developed on the basis of internal staff surveys, the CA Immo Academy offers modular training and instruction at all sites in three core areas:
- Business: Training and specific skills development in the various areas of work
- Skills: Personal development, social skills training for individual needs
- Health & Fit: Promoting and sustaining capacity to work through the acquisition of communication and stress management techniques
For the current year, we are specifically offering (remote) training courses on the following topics:
- Regular management training courses
- Annual Professional Program (Fire)
- Health lectures
- Regular updates on various current topics in the specialist areas
- Specific training courses such as Excel training (online), negotiation training (online), personality training
- Coaching on various topics for managers and employees
- Continuous offers on current hot-topics or depending on the demand: e.g. Leading without professional leadership skills, moderation and presentation training, communication training, conflict management
- Language training
- Teambuildings
- Welcome Days
- Inhouse training on various tools like Webex, Bim, etc.
